Perng W, Cnattingius S, Iliadou A, Villamor E. Perinatal characteristics and risk of polio among Swedish twins. Paediatric and Perinatal Epidemiology 2012; 26: 218–225. Prenatal exposure to adverse environmental conditions is related to increased adult mortality in regions where infections are highly prevalent, yet there is little evidence of the impact of perinatal conditions on the risk of severe infections throughout life. Using prospectively collected data from 21 604 like‐sexed Swedish twins of known zygosity born in 1926–1958, we examined the risk of polio in relation to perinatal characteristics using cohort and nested co‐twin case–control analyses. Polio incidence was determined through an interview in 1998, and linkage with the Swedish national inpatient and death registries. There were 133 cases of polio. In the cohort analysis, birth length, birthweight and head circumference were positively associated with polio risk. After adjustment for sex, birth year, gestational age at birth and within‐twin pair correlations, twins of shortest length (<44 cm) had a 67% ([95% CI: 6%, 88%]; P = 0.04) lower risk of polio compared with the reference group (47–49 cm). After additional adjustment for birth length, every 100‐g increase in birthweight was related to a 34% increased risk of polio ([95% CI: ?1%, 82%]; P = 0.06), and every 10‐mm increase in head circumference was related to a 17% greater risk of polio ([95% CI: 5%, 31%]; P = 0.004). In co‐twin control analyses among 226 disease‐discordant twins, birth length, birthweight and head circumference were 0.3 cm (P = 0.19), 84 g (P = 0.07) and 3 mm (P = 0.08) higher in cases than controls, respectively. Similar associations were observed among monozygotic (n = 84) and dizygotic (n = 142) twins. These findings suggest that early intrauterine growth restriction may be inversely related to the incidence of polio.  相似文献

活产双胎低出生体重儿影响因素分析   总被引:1,自引:0,他引:1  
目的探讨活产双胎低出生体重与相关因素关系。方法将657对活产双胎按出生体重分为体重均低组、单低体重组和体重正常组,配对分析双胎性别、出生次序与低出生体重的关系;分析母亲因素(孕龄、孕周、孕次、产次、血压、血红蛋白等)与出生体重的关系。结果双胎中第2个出生胎儿为低体重者明显多于第1个出生胎儿,女婴显著多于男婴。各体重组母亲孕周、产次比较差异有统计学意义;低体重组母亲孕初舒张压显著低于正常组,血红蛋白值始终高于体重正常组。结论双胎低出生体重与胎儿性别、出生顺序、母亲孕周、产次有关。双胎母亲孕期血压、血红蛋白与胎儿低出生体重间的关系是否属于对双胎妊娠的一种适应,有待进一步探讨。  相似文献

双生子A型人格与高血压及血生化指标研究   总被引:3,自引:0,他引:3  
目的 了解双生子A型人格与高血压及血液生化指标的关系。方法 利用遗传流行病学方法对青岛市89对24岁以上双生子(同卵55对,异卵34对)进行调查。并进行A型人格测试,以比较同卵与异卵双生于A型人格得分的相关程度、A型人格及血压的一致性。推测遗传与环境因素对A型人格的影响,A型人格与高血压的关系,并探讨血液生化指标与A型人格的关系。结果 经KAPPA一致性检验,同卵(MZ)双生子之间A型人格存在着显的一致性(P<0.001),而异卵(DZ)双生子之间的一致性无显性差异(P=0.802)。同时,MZ双生子之间A型人格和血压也存在显的一致性(P<0.001),而DZ双生子之间A型人格和血压无明显一致性(P=0.102)。有A型人格的双生子血压的收缩压明显高于非A型人格的双生子(P<0.05)。许多生化指标与A型人格因素相关,但是所计算出的相关系数大都小于0.30,属于弱相关。结论 MZ双生子A型人格及高血压之间存在着显的一致性,而这种一致性在DZ双生子表现不明显。A型人格是高血压的危险因素之一。A型人格与所研究血液基本生化指标之间相关较弱。  相似文献

Birth weight and risk of angina pectoris: analysis in Swedish twins   总被引:2,自引:0,他引:2  
Objective: Intrauterine nutrition approximated by birth weight has been shown to be inversely associated with risk of coronary heart disease (CHD). By investigating the association within twin pairs discordant for disease, the influence of genetic and early environmental factors is substantially reduced. Methods: We have investigated the association between birth weight and angina pectoris in same-sexed twins with known zygosity included in the population-based Swedish Twin Registry. Self-reports of birth weight and angina pectoris were collected in a telephone interview between 1998 and 2000. The cohort analyses were based on 4594 same-sexed twins, and the within-pair analyses included 55 dizygotic and 37 monozygotic twin pairs discordant for angina pectoris. Odds ratios (OR) and 95% confidence intervals (CI) were calculated by logistic regression. Results: Compared with birth weight between 2.0 and 2.9 kg, low birth weight (<2.0 kg) was associated with increased risk of angina pectoris in the twin cohort, (OR: 1.46; 95% CI: 1.14–1.87), but after adjustment for potential confounders the risk decreased, and did not reach significance. Within twin pairs discordant for angina pectoris, low birth weight was significantly associated with increased risk of angina pectoris within dizygotic twins (adjusted OR: 5.73; 95% CI: 1.59–20.67), but not within monozygotic twins (adjusted OR: 1.20; 95% CI: 0.40–3.58). Conclusions: The results suggest that genetic differences associated with foetal growth and adult risk of CHD may have affected previously reported associations between birth weight and CHD.  相似文献

Twins can be used to investigate the biological basis for observed associations between birth weight and later disease risk, as they experience in utero growth restriction compared with singletons, which can differ in magnitude within twin pairs despite partial or total genetic identity. In the present study, sixty monozygotic and seventy-one dizygotic same-sex twin pairs aged 19-50 years and eighty-nine singleton controls matched for age, gestational age, sex, maternal age and parity were recruited from an obstetric database. Associations between fasting lipid levels and birth weight were assessed by linear regression with adjustment for possible confounding factors. Twins were significantly lighter at birth but were not significantly different in adult height, weight or lipid levels from the singleton controls. There was a significant inverse association between birth weight and both total and LDL-cholesterol levels among singleton controls (-0.53 mmol/l per kg (95 % CI -0.97, -0.09), P = 0.02 and -0.39 mmol/l per kg (95 % CI -0.76, -0.02), P = 0.04, respectively), but there was no significant association between birth weight and lipid levels in either unpaired or within-pair analysis of twins. The results suggest that the in utero growth restriction and early catch-up growth experienced by twins does not increase the risk of an atherogenic lipid profile in adult life.  相似文献

There is evidence from singletons that maternal birthweight is positively related to offspring gestational length and birthweight, and some evidence of an inverse relationship with preterm birth. Among twins very preterm birth is the major cause of neonatal mortality and of immediate and later morbidity, including neurodevelopmental impairment. We hypothesised that the relationship between maternal birthweight and gestational length would be more evident in twin than in singleton pregnancies, as there is more variation in gestation in the former. Among 131 singleton mothers carrying twins, there was weak evidence of a positive relationship between maternal birthweight and twin gestational length (+0.6 weeks [95% CI -0.05, +1.3] per kg increase in maternal birthweight, but stronger evidence among 56 of these who went into labour spontaneously (+1.9 weeks [+0.7, +3.1], P = 0.003 for interaction). In the latter group we estimated that the odds of very preterm birth (at <32 weeks) were reduced by 50% [95% CI 10%, 82%] per 250 g increase in maternal birthweight. In the whole cohort, and in this subgroup, maternal birthweight was strongly positively related to both twin offspring total birthweight and total placental weight. Our data, consistent with intergenerational programming of early development, suggest the possibility of a stronger and more clinically relevant association among twins than among singletons. Nevertheless, our sample size was modest and this finding needs to be confirmed in a larger cohort.  相似文献

In order to elucidate whether maternal plurality affects offspring intrauterine growth, the relationship between birthweight and gestational age of twins and singletons and those of their first singleton liveborn children in Norway was studied using data from the Medical Birth Registry. The population-based sample consisted of 49 698 mother–offspring pairs (48 842 with singleton and 856 with twin-mothers). In bivariate analyses, no significant differences in mean birthweight and gestational age of offspring of twin and singleton mothers were found, although the mean birthweight and gestational age of the twin-mothers themselves were significantly lower than those of singletons (819 g and 14 days respectively). In multiple regression analysis, the expected birthweight of offspring was 230.3 g (95% CI: 193.2–267.4 g) higher when the mother was a twin than when the mother was a singleton, when controlling for non-standardised maternal birthweight. When adjusting for relative maternal birthweight ( z -score), the association between maternal plurality and offspring birthweight was not statistically significant. The results suggest that being born as a twin has no substantial consequences on offspring growth in utero and show that mean differences in birthweight between twins and singletons should be standardised when both groups are included in multivariate studies.  相似文献

Lifestyle factors in monozygotic and dizygotic twins   总被引:1,自引:0,他引:1  
In examining genetic influences on biological variables using twins, it may be important to examine the distribution between and within twin pairs of demographic and lifestyle factors that may themselves affect the biological variable being studied. We explored the distribution of demographic and lifestyle factors that may affect blood lipid levels or ischaemic heart disease (IHD) risk among a sample of 106 monozygotic (MZ) and 94 like-sex dizygotic (DZ) twin pairs. In our sample, MZ twins were statistically significantly different from DZ twins only in marital status, cigarette smoking habits, and the ratio of polyunsaturated to saturated fat (P:S ratio) in their dietary intake. The latter variable was among many dietary variables examined (using 4-day weighed food diaries), and the size of the difference in intake was small. When comparisons were made of the similarities within twin pairs, we found members of MZ twin pairs to be statistically significantly closer than DZ twins in educational achievement, occupation, cigarette smoking, and exercise habits, and the number of days a week on which alcohol was consumed. These last three variables were consistently closer among twins with closer contact than among those with a smaller degree of current shared environment. For 12 of the 13 nutrients examined, the within-pair correlations were higher for MZ than for DZ twins, although our test for significant genetic variance showed statistical significance only for intake of complex carbohydrates. We conclude that MZ twins share demographic and lifestyle factors that might influence the risk of IHD and blood lipid levels to a greater degree than do DZ twins, although it is difficult to say if these similarities in lifestyle result from genetic influences or not. Nevertheless, ascribing differences between correlations in MZ and DZ twin pairs for lipid levels as being purely "genetic"--as implicit in conventional measures of heritability--is likely to overestimate the influence of genetic factors.  相似文献

Public health recommendations promote physical activity to improve health and longevity. Recent data suggest that the association between physical activity and mortality may be due to genetic selection. Using data on twins, the authors investigated whether genetic selection explains the association between physical activity and mortality. Data were based on a postal questionnaire answered by 13,109 Swedish twin pairs in 1972. The national Cause of Death Register was used for information about all-cause mortality (n=1,800) and cardiovascular disease mortality (n=638) during 1975-2004. The risk of death was reduced by 34% for men (relative risk=0.64, 95% confidence interval: 0.50, 0.83) and by 25% for women (relative risk=0.75, 95% confidence interval: 0.50, 1.14) reporting high physical activity levels. Within-pair comparisons of monozygotic twins showed that, compared with their less active co-twin, the more active twin had a 20% (odds ratio=0.80, 95% confidence interval: 0.65, 0.99) reduced risk of all-cause mortality and a 32% (odds ratio=0.68, 95% confidence interval: 0.49, 0.95) reduced risk of cardiovascular disease mortality. Results indicate that physical activity is associated with a reduced risk of mortality not due to genetic selection. This finding supports a causal link between physical activity and mortality.  相似文献

目的 分析双胎发育不均衡早产儿生后早期并发症及纠正年龄12月时神经发育的差异,为双胎发育不均衡早产儿预防并发症提供依据。方法 采用前瞻性队列研究,选择2016年1月1日-2017年12月31日郑州大学第三附属医院新生儿科收治的活产、双胎且出生体重差异≥25%,除外双胎输血综合征的早产儿67对,分为轻胎组67例,重胎组67例,观察其生后早期并发症和纠正年龄12月以内的神经发育发育情况。结果 1)轻胎组发生新生儿呼吸窘迫综合征(NRDS)、喂养不耐受和感染性疾病的比例,住院期间放弃或死亡例数及住院天数均高于重胎组,差异有统计学意义(t=4.418、4.251、3.983、5.858、4.733,P<0.05)。2)双胎均痊愈出院者共55对,随访至纠正年龄12月者43对。在不同出生胎龄中(<32周,32~33+6周,34~36+6周),轻胎组新生儿行为神经测定(NBNA)得分均显著低于重胎组(6月龄:t=3.735、2.494、2.129;12龄:t=4.850、3.269、3.381,P<0.001);纠正年龄6月和12月龄时,不同胎龄中,轻胎组与重胎组智力发育指数(MDI)差异均无统计学意义(P>0.05),而轻胎组运动发育指数(PDI)均显著低于重胎组(t=4.269、3.233、2.578,P<0.01)。结论 双胎发育不均衡的早产儿中,低出生体重小者生后早期并发症多,预后不良的发生率较高,要严密随访,尤其注意运动能力的发育状况。  相似文献

Maternal smoking and adverse birth outcomes among singletons and twins   总被引:13,自引:0,他引:13       下载免费PDF全文
OBJECTIVES: This study assessed the effects of maternal smoking on birth outcomes among singletons and twins. METHODS: An algorithm was developed to link twins with their siblings in the 1995 Perinatal Mortality Data Set. A random-effects logistic regression model was then used to estimate the association between maternal smoking and several adverse outcomes for a random sample of singletons and for all twins with available maternal smoking information. RESULTS: The algorithm successfully linked sibling pairs for 91% of the twin sample. Maternal smoking was associated with a significantly increased risk of low birthweight, very low birthweight, and gestation of less than 33 weeks for both singletons and twins and with an increased risk of gestation of less than 38 weeks, infant mortality, and placental abruption for singletons. Among smokers, negative impacts on the risk of low birthweight, very low birthweight, and extreme premature delivery were significantly higher for women carrying twins. CONCLUSIONS: Some of the negative effects of smoking on low birthweight and preterm delivery are greater for twins than for singletons. Women carrying twins should be warned that smoking increases their already high risk of serious infant health problems.  相似文献

OBJECTIVE: An inverse association between body height and the incidence of coronary heart disease (CHD) has been observed. However, the mechanisms behind this association are still largely unknown. We will examine the role of genetic and familial factors behind the association in a large twin data set. DESIGN AND SETTING: The data were derived from the Finnish Twin cohort including 2438 singletons, 4073 monozygotic (MZ) twins, and 9202 dizygotic (DZ) twins aged 25-69 years at baseline in 1976. Incident CHD cases were derived from hospital discharge data and cause of death data between 1977 and 1995. Cox regression analysis and conditional logistic regression analysis were used. RESULTS: In population-level analyses no differences in the general risk of CHD between zygosity groups were found. The association between body height and CHD was similar between sexes and zygosity groups. When men and women in all zygosity groups were studied together an increased risk of CHD was found only among the shortest quartile (hazard ratio [HR] = 1.34, 95% CI: 1.14-1.57). Among the twin pairs discordant for CHD a suggestive increased risk for the shorter twin was seen among DZ twins (odds ratio [OR] = 1.19, 95% CI: 0.95-1.48) when men and women were studied together. CONCLUSION: An inverse association between body height and CHD was broadly similar between sexes and twin zygosity groups and was associated with short stature. Among discordant twin pairs we found a weak association among DZ twins but not MZ twins. This may suggest the role of genetic liability behind the association between body height and CHD.  相似文献

Childhood neurological disorders in twins   总被引:2,自引:0,他引:2  
Summary. In order to examine neurological outcome in twins, a multicentre prospective cohort study of infants was used. Women entered at the first prenatal visit, with follow-up of offspring to the age of 7 years. Outcome measures were death, cerebral palsy, seizure disorders including neonatal, febrile or nonfebrile, and intelligence quotient. Among a total of 52364 livebirths, there were 1079 twins. Overall, rates of fetal or neonatal death and cerebral palsy were higher in twins. Neonatal and febrile seizures occurred with similar frequency in twins as in singletons. Although twins were much more likely than singletons to be low in birthweight, twins < 2500 g were not at higher risk for cerebral palsy than low birthweight singletons. The risk of cerebral palsy and of nonfebrile seizure disorders was similar in monozygous and dizygous pairs, and in like-sex and unlike-sex pairs. Death of one twin was associated with higher rates of cerebral palsy and of nonfebrile seizure disorders in survivors, but not with lowered intelligence. Data from this cohort suggest that low birthweight and survival status of the co-twin are dominant predictors of childhood neurological morbidity in twins.  相似文献

BACKGROUND: An inverse association between birthweight and later blood pressure has been found in many studies in singletons. Twin studies have been used to examine whether genetic factors or family environment could account for this association. METHODS: A systematic review identified 10 studies covering 3901 twin pairs. Meta-analysis of regression coefficients for the association between birthweight and systolic blood pressure was carried out for unpaired versus paired associations and for paired associations in dizygotic versus monozygotic pairs. RESULTS: After adjustment for current weight or body mass index (BMI), the difference in systolic blood pressure per kg birthweight was -2.0 (95% CI: -3.2, -0.8) mmHg in the unpaired analysis and -0.4 (95% CI: -1.5, 0.7) mmHg in the paired analysis in the same subjects. In the paired analysis by zygosity, in all twins the coefficients were -0.7 (95% CI: -2.3, 0.8) mmHg in dizygotic pairs and -0.8 (95% CI: -2.1, 0.4) mmHg in monozygotic pairs, but in studies which included zygosity tests the coefficients were -1.0 (95% CI: -3.3, 1.6) mmHg in dizygotic pairs and -0.4 (95% CI: -1.9, 1.3) mmHg in monozygotic pairs. CONCLUSIONS: The attenuation of the regression coefficient in the paired analysis provides support for the possibility that factors shared by twins contribute to the association between birthweight and blood pressure in singletons. Comparison of paired analysis in monozygotic and dizygotic pairs could not provide conclusive evidence for a role for genetic as opposed to shared environmental factors.  相似文献

OBJECTIVE: Eating disorders have high comorbidity with mood, anxiety, and substance use disorders. Using twins from the population-based Minnesota Twin Family Study (MTFS), we examined comorbidity and shared transmission between eating pathology and these disorders. METHOD: Female twins (N = 672), ages 16-18 years, completed structured clinical interviews assessing anorexia nervosa and bulimia nervosa (as described in the 4th ed. of the Diagnostic and Statistical Manual of Mental Disorders [DSM-IV; American Psychiatric Association, 1994]), as well as mood, anxiety, and substance use disorders (as described in the 3rd Rev. ed. of the Diagnostic and Statistical Manual of Mental Disorders [DSM-III-R]). Shared transmission was examined using a discordant monozygotic (MZ) twin design. RESULTS: Significant comorbidity was found between eating disorders and major depression, anxiety disorders, and nicotine dependence. Within MZ twin pairs discordant for eating disorders (n = 14), non-eating-disordered cotwins demonstrated increased risk for anxiety disorders compared with controls. Similarly, within MZ twin pairs discordant for anxiety disorders (n = 52), non-anxiety-disordered cotwins demonstrated increased risk for eating disorders compared with controls. DISCUSSION: Findings support shared transmission between eating disorders and anxiety disorders. However, the nature of this shared diathesis remains unknown.  相似文献

PURPOSE: Dependent binary responses, such as health outcomes in twin pairs or siblings, frequently arise in perinatal epidemiologic research. This gives rise to correlated data, which must be taken into account during analysis to avoid erroneous statistical and biological inferences. METHODS: An analysis of perinatal mortality (fetal deaths plus deaths within the first 28 days) in twins in relation to cluster-varying (those that are unique to each fetus within a twin pregnancy such as birthweight) and cluster-constant (those that are identical for both twins within a sibship such as maternal smoking status) risk factors is presented. Marginal (ordinary logistic regression [OLR] and logistic regression using generalized estimating equations [GEE]) and cluster-specific (conditional and random-intercept logistic regression models) regression models are fit and their results contrasted. The United States "matched multiple data" file of twin births (1995-1997), which includes 285,226 twins from 142,613 pregnancies, was used to examine the implications of ignoring of clustering on regression inferences. RESULTS: The OLR models provide variance estimates for cluster constant covariates that ranged from 7% to 71% smaller than those from GEE-based models. This underestimation is even more pronounced for some cluster-varying covariates, ranging from 21% to 198%. CONCLUSIONS: Ignoring the cluster dependency is likely to affect the precision of covariate effects and consequently interpretation of results. With widespread availability of appropriate software, statistical methods for taking the intracluster dependency into account are easily implemented and necessary.  相似文献

We examined the risk of atopic diseases in twins born after assisted reproduction. Data on atopic diseases and assisted reproduction in 9694 twin pairs, 3-20 years of age, from the Danish Twin Registry were collected via multidisciplinary questionnaires. The risk of atopic diseases in twins born after assisted reproduction was compared with the risk in twins born after spontaneous conception using logistic regression and variance components analysis. Children born after assisted reproduction did not have a different risk of atopic outcomes (adjusted odds ratios [95% confidence intervals] for asthma: 0.95 [0.85, 1.07], P = 0.403; hay fever: 1.01 [0.86, 1.18], P = 0.918; and atopic dermatitis: 1.02 [0.81, 1.11], P = 0.773 respectively) compared with children born after spontaneous conception. Assisted reproduction did not modify the heritability of atopic diseases. This study does not support an association between assisted reproduction and development of atopic diseases. This result must be confirmed in subsequent studies, preferably of singleton populations.  相似文献

Most previous studies of burnout have focused on work environmental stressors, while familial factors so far mainly have been overlooked. The aim of the study was to estimate the relative importance of genetic influences on burnout (measured with Pines Burnout Measure) in a sample of monozygotic (MZ) and dizygotic (DZ) Swedish twins. The study sample consisted of 20,286 individuals, born 1959–1986 from the Swedish twin registry who participated in the cross-sectional study of twin adults: genes and environment. Probandwise concordance rates (the risk for one twin to be affected given that his/her twin partner is affected by burnout) and within pair correlations were calculated for MZ and DZ same—and opposite sexed twin pairs. Heritability coefficients i.e. the proportion of the total variance attributable to genetic factors were calculated using standard biometrical model fitting procedures. The results showed that genetic factors explained 33% of the individual differences in burnout symptoms in women and men. Environmental factors explained a substantial part of the variation as well and are thus important to address in rehabilitation and prevention efforts to combat burnout.  相似文献

The fetal growth curve and neonatal mortality rate, based on gestational age and birthweight, are important for identifying groups of high-risk neonates and developing appropriate medical services and health-care programmes. The purpose of this study was to develop a national fetal growth curve for neonates in Korea, and examine the Korean national references for fetal growth and death according to their characteristics. Data of Korean vital statistics linked National Infant Mortality Survey conducted on births in 1999 were used in this study. The total livebirths were 621,764 in 1999, which were grouped into singletons (n = 609,643) and twins (n = 9805) for analysis. Birthweight/gestational age-specific fetal growth curves and neonatal mortality rates were based on 250 g of birthweight and weekly gestational age intervals for each characteristic of the birth. The features of high-risk neonates such as small-for-gestational-age and the limit of viability in Korea were different from those of Western countries. Difference in fetal growth and death was also detected in other characteristics of the fetus (gender and plurality of birth) besides race. The fetal growth curve of males was higher than that of females, and was higher in singleton than in twins. The neonatal mortality rate was higher in males (singleton, 2.6; twin, 23.5) than females (singleton, 2.1; twin, 15.9), and higher in twins (19.8/1000) than in singletons (2.4/1000). However, in neonates with gestational age >29 weeks and birthweight >1000 g, the neonatal mortality rate was lower in twins than in singletons. The limit of viability was gestational age 27 weeks and birthweight 1000 g, which was similar in singletons and twins regardless of gender. To improve the health of neonates in a country, it is imperative to investigate the characteristics of fetal growth and death under the particular circumstances of the country. When risk is defined for neonates account must be taken of differences in race, gender and plurality of birth, as the neonatal mortality rate varies depending on those factors.  相似文献
